zk-SNARKs: Teorik Atılımdan Gizlilik ve Ölçeklenebilirlik Uygulamalarına

robot
Abstract generation in progress

zk-SNARKs teknolojisinin gelişimi ve uygulama özeti

Tarihsel Gelişim

Sıfır Bilgi Kanıtı sistemi, 1985 yılında Goldwasser, Micali ve Rackoff'un öncü makalesine dayanmaktadır. Bu makale, etkileşimli sistemlerde, en az bilgi alışverişi ile beyanların doğruluğunu kanıtlama olasılığını araştırmaktadır. Erken dönem sıfır bilgi kanıtı sistemleri, verimlilik ve pratiklik açısından yetersizdi ve yalnızca teorik düzeyde kalıyordu. Son on yılda, kriptografinin kripto para alanında yükselmesiyle birlikte, sıfır bilgi kanıtı önemli bir araştırma yönü haline geldi.

Önemli突破包括:

  • 2010 yılında Groth, kısa eşleşme etkileşimsiz zk-SNARKs önerdi.
  • 2013'teki Pinocchio protokolü sıkıştırma kanıtı ve doğrulama süresi
  • 2016 yılında Groth16, kanıt boyutunu küçültüp doğrulama verimliliğini artırdı
  • 2017'de Bulletproofs, güvenilir kurulum gerektirmeyen kısa kanıtlar sundu.
  • 2018 yılında zk-STARKs önerilen post-kuantum güvenli protokol

Diğer önemli gelişmeler arasında PLONK, Halo2 gibi projeler de bulunmaktadır.

HashKey ZK 101 İlk Bölüm: Tarihsel Prensipler ve Sektör

Ana Uygulamalar

zk-SNARKs, gizlilik koruma ve ölçeklenebilirlik açısından iki ana alanda uygulanmaktadır.

gizlilik koruma

Temsilci projeler şunlardır:

  • Zcash: İşlem gizliliği sağlamak için zk-SNARKs kullanır
  • Monero: Bulletproofs algoritmasını kullanıyor
  • Tornado Cash: Ethereum tabanlı karıştırıcı havuzu

Gizli işlemlerin zorluğu nispeten düşük, ancak gerçek uygulama beklentilerin altında kaldı.

HashKey ZK 101 İlk Dönem: Tarihsel İlkeler ve Sektör

genişletme

zk-SNARKs, ölçeklendirme konusunda geniş bir şekilde uygulanmaktadır; örneğin, Mina birinci katman ağ uygulamaları ve çeşitli ikinci katman ağları için ZK-rollup çözümleri.

ZK-rollup temel prensibi:

  1. Sequencer işlemleri paketler
  2. Aggregatör işlemleri birleştirir ve kanıt oluşturur
  3. Kanıtı bir katman ağında doğrulama ve durum güncellemesi için gönderin.

Ana akım ZK-rollup projeleri arasında StarkNet, zkSync, Aztec, Polygon Hermez gibi projeler bulunmaktadır. Teknik yol haritası esas olarak SNARK ve STARK arasında seçim yapmakta ve EVM uyumluluğu ile ilgilidir.

HashKey ZK 101 İlk Dönem: Tarihsel Prensipler ve Sektör

Temel Prensipler

zk-SNARKs örneği olarak, uygulanma adımları şunlardır:

  1. Sorunu devreye dönüştürmek
  2. Devre R1CS biçimine dönüştürülür
  3. R1CS'in QAP biçimine dönüştürülmesi
  4. Güvenilir ayar parametrelerini oluşturun
  5. zk-SNARKs oluşturma ve doğrulama

zk-SNARKs, bütünlük, güvenilirlik ve sıfır bilgi olmak üzere üç özelliği karşılamalıdır.

HashKey ZK 101 1. Dönem: Tarihsel Prensipler ve Sektör

Genel olarak, zk-SNARKs teknolojisi hızla gelişmekte olup, gizlilik ve ölçeklenebilirlik alanında büyük bir potansiyel sergilemektedir. Gelecekte daha fazla alanda yaygın olarak kullanılması beklenmektedir.

HashKey ZK 101 İlk Dönem: Tarihi İlkeler ve Sektör

ZK2.62%
View Original
This page may contain third-party content, which is provided for information purposes only (not representations/warranties) and should not be considered as an endorsement of its views by Gate, nor as financial or professional advice. See Disclaimer for details.
  • Reward
  • 5
  • Repost
  • Share
Comment
0/400
DefiOldTrickstervip
· 07-28 23:27
85 yıl önce kurulan Şaşkın Fare hâlâ çok genç! O zamanlar ben de çok kaybettim.
View OriginalReply0
UncommonNPCvip
· 07-28 13:10
Bu teknoloji çok havalı.
View OriginalReply0
LiquidityWitchvip
· 07-27 02:52
Bu sadece sıradan bir iterasyon yükseltmesi değil mi?
View OriginalReply0
SleepyValidatorvip
· 07-27 02:46
zk-SNARKs boğa bir şeydir.
View OriginalReply0
MEVHunterWangvip
· 07-27 02:34
Zk'yi sekiz yıldır yiyorum!
View OriginalReply0
  • Pin
Trade Crypto Anywhere Anytime
qrCode
Scan to download Gate App
Community
  • 简体中文
  • English
  • Tiếng Việt
  • 繁體中文
  • Español
  • Русский
  • Français (Afrique)
  • Português (Portugal)
  • Bahasa Indonesia
  • 日本語
  • بالعربية
  • Українська
  • Português (Brasil)